Wealth First Portfolio Managers Limited – Investor Presentation Summary

Key Operational Highlights

  • Acquisition target Wealth First Advisors Private Limited (WFAPL) is a wealth management and financial distribution firm established in 2001.
  • The target company has a 25-year track record and provides investment advisory, mutual fund distribution, and sub-broking services.
  • The company has a strong presence in Maharashtra with clients across HNI & UHNI individuals.

Key drivers of operational performance:

The acquisition is aimed at accelerating AUM growth through acquisition-led expansion and expanding the client base across affluent and HNI segments.

Financial Highlights

  • Phase I Acquisition Consideration: ₹52.1 crores for 51% stake
  • Cash Component: ₹40 crores
  • Share Swap Component: ₹12.1 crores
  • Phase II Acquisition: Remaining 49% stake to be acquired in FY30, consideration determined by valuation report and settled entirely through share swap

Geographical Revenue Split

  • The target company is based out of Mumbai and has a strong presence in Maharashtra.
  • The acquisition expands the Company's distribution footprint, strengthening its presence in Mumbai (Maharashtra) alongside its existing network in Ahmedabad, Surat, Pune, and Rest of the World.

Strategic & R&D Initiatives

  • Strategic rationale includes scale acceleration, expanded distribution reach, broader product offerings, and unlocking cross-selling opportunities.
  • The acquisition brings together two like-minded organizations sharing a common belief in independent advice, client-first thinking, and entrepreneurial ownership.
  • Key talent & relationship managers to be retained with smooth client transition planned.

Industry Trends & Business Environment

  • Projected Wealth Management AUM by FY29: ~US$9 Tn (up from ~US$1.1 Tn in FY24)
  • Annual Growth in India's HNI Population: ~12–16%, reaching ~1.65 mn by 2027
  • Projected Liquid Wealth by 2035: ~US$300 Bn AUM for specialist wealth managers
  • Financialisation Headroom: MF AUM ~15–17% of GDP vs ~60–65% global average
  • Affluent & HNI Families: ~26,000 HNI Families by 2030, a 60% YoY growth from ~16,000 in 2025
  • Alternatives Opportunity: Alternative assets market projected ~5× growth to ~US$2 Tn by 2034

Management Commentary & Growth Outlook

  • Mr. Ashish Shah, Managing Director, stated: "This acquisition is about bringing together two likeminded organizations... creating a stronger platform with the scale, talent, and capabilities to serve more families, expand our presence across India, and accelerate our journey towards becoming one of the country's leading independent wealth and asset management institutions."
  • The transaction is being executed entirely through a share swap rather than a cash exit for the promoter, underscoring continued commitment and confidence in the company's future growth.
  • Transaction of Phase I will tentatively be completed on or before 31st December 2026 subject to requisite approvals.
